Philip B. Agins, 25, of Greenman Avenue, Westerly, died April 14, 2008, in the Lawrence & Memorial Hospital, New London. Born in Westerly, he was the beloved son of Alan Agins of Tucson, Ariz., and Paula (McCuin) Agins of Westerly. Philip was a self-employed musician. He played with "The...
